Garanga - Kharar, S.A.S Nagar
Garanga is a village situated in the Kharar tehsil of S.A.S Nagar district, Punjab. It is located approximately 11 km from Kharar and around 19 km from Sahibzada Ajit Singh Nagar. Garangan serves as the Gram Panchayat for Garanga village.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Garanga is 039104. The village covers a total geographical area of 252 hectares and falls under the 140413 pincode. Kharar is the nearest town.
Garanga village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Dera bassi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Patiala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.
Population of Garanga
According to the 2011 Census, Garanga village had a total population of 1,481 people, including 814 males and 667 females, living in 310 households. The sex ratio was 819 females per 1,000 males. The overall literacy rate was 79.41%, with male literacy at 83.29% and female literacy at 74.71%. The Scheduled Caste (SC) population was 597.
The table below presents a detailed demographic breakdown of the village, including separate male and female figures for each population category.
| Category | Total | Male | Female |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total Population | 1,481 | 814 | 667 |
|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 160 | 90 | 70 |
| Scheduled Castes (SC) | 597 | 333 | 264 |
|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 0 | 0 | 0 |
| Literate Population | 1,049 | 603 | 446 |
| Illiterate Population | 432 | 211 | 221 |

Transport and Connectivity of Garanga
Garanga is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through bus services. The nearest railway station is located within 5-10 km of Garanga.
| Connectivity |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Public Bus Service | Yes | Available within village |
| Private Bus Service | Yes | Available within village |
| Railway Station | No | Available within 5-10 km |
In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. the road distance from Sahibzada Ajit Singh Nagar to Garanga is about 19 km, with the usual travel time around 30-60 minutes.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
Banking and Postal Services in Garanga
Banking and postal services are essential for daily financial transactions and communication. The availability of these facilities for Garanga village is detailed below:
| Service Type |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Bank | Yes | Available within village |
| ATM | No | Available within 5-10 km |
| Post Office | Yes | Available within village |
Health Facilities in Garanga
Healthcare facilities play an important role in providing basic medical services to the residents. The details regarding the nearest health centres and hospitals serving Garanga village are given below:
| Facility Type |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Health Sub-Centre (HSC) | Yes | Available within village |
| Primary Health Centre (PHC) | No | Available within 2-5 km |
| Community Health Centre (CHC) | No | Available within 2-5 km |
